WebJul 16, 2024 · In most cases, a parrot’s beak peels because it is shedding an old, outer layer of the beak. Your parrot’s beak is always growing, so the old layers flake off to reveal a new healthy layer. WebFeb 4, 2013 · The Parrot Beak. Parrots are often called hookbills, which is an avicultural term based on the shape of the beak or bill. This distinguishes parrots from softbills and other birds, such as doves and finches. The function of the parrot beak is for climbing, as well as manipulating and crushing objects. Apr 27, 2015 · WebIf your bird is normal and healthy, you shouldn't observe any major change in beak length over time. (The normal growth rate for a canary's beak is approximately just 1 ¼ - 1 ½ inches per year). If your bird's beak appears to be overgrown, it is imperative to have your bird examined by a veterinarian. An overgrown beak can be a sign of ...
